Key Points:

  • Connor Hellebuyck made a crucial paddle save against Team Canada’s Devon Toews in the second period to keep the Olympic men’s ice hockey gold medal game tied.
  • Team USA won its first Olympic gold in men’s ice hockey since 1980, with Jack Hughes scoring the game-winning goal in 3-on-3 overtime.
  • Hellebuyck, a three-time Vezina Trophy winner and reigning Hart Trophy MVP, stopped 41 shots amid intense pressure from Canada throughout the game.
  • The victory was celebrated as a historic moment, with Hellebuyck describing it as a dream come true and one of the most fun hockey experiences of his career.
